Critical thinking can be defined as the ability to analyze, evaluate, and interpret information in order to form a rational judgment or decision. It involves the process of actively and skillfully conceptualizing, applying, analyzing, synthesizing, and evaluating information gathered from observation, experience, reflection, reasoning, or communication. Critical thinking is crucial in problem-solving, decision-making, and forming well-reasoned opinions and arguments.
Communication skills, on the other hand, refer to the ability to convey information clearly and effectively through various means such as speaking, writing, and listening. Good communication skills are essential in building relationships, exchanging ideas, and collaborating with others. Effective communication involves not only transmitting information but also receiving feedback, understanding different perspectives, and adapting the message to suit the needs of the audience.
